Description: A secretary is an administrative professional who provides support to individuals or teams within an organization. They perform a wide range of tasks including managing correspondence, scheduling appointments, organizing meetings, maintaining files and records, and handling phone calls. Secretaries also handle administrative duties such as drafting memos, preparing reports, and coordinating travel arrangements. They often act as the first point of contact for both internal and external stakeholders, ensuring effective communication within the organization.
